Foggy Window Replacement: Understanding the Process, Options, and Costs
Foggy windows are a typical issue in numerous homes, particularly in environments that experience significant temperature level variations and high humidity levels. This phenomenon occurs when moisture seeps into the insulated glass unit (IGU) in between the panes. The condensation not only obstructs exposure however can likewise suggest a loss in energy effectiveness, leading many house owners to consider foggy window replacement. This post provides a thorough take a look at the process of changing foggy windows, the alternatives readily available, and the associated costs.
Understanding Foggy Windows
Meaning: Foggy windows describe a condition where the glass appears cloudy or hazy due to moisture caught between the panes. This concern typically represents that the seal of the window has actually failed, allowing air and moisture to get in.

Foggy windows can impact a home in the following methods:

Replacing foggy windows can be a straightforward process, however it does require careful planning and execution. Below is a comprehensive introduction of the steps included:
Step-by-Step Replacement Process
Evaluation of the Damage:
A professional inspector ought to evaluate the condition of the windows to figure out the degree of the fogging and any underlying concerns.
Picking the Right Replacement Option:
Homeowners can choose between changing the entire window system or simply the insulated glass. This decision frequently depends on the degree of the damage and budget factors to consider.
Sourcing Materials:
If replacing just the glass, choose high-quality IGUs that match the home's climate and aesthetic preferences.
Setup:
Professional installers will remove the old window or glass pane, clean the location, and set up the brand-new unit, guaranteeing that all seals are tight and secure.
Final Inspection:
